Fretz Sandstone Hammer - HMR-22

The Fretz HMR-22 is a texturing hammer with a fine, grainy face that leaves a stippled pattern closer to worn sandstone than a mechanical texture. It's one of the hammers we reach for most in workshops, since the pattern reads as natural and irregular rather than stamped or repetitive.

Like the rest of the Fretz range, the head is cast from 420 stainless steel and hardened, so the texture holds up strike after strike instead of smoothing out with use. The hardwood handle is shaped and weighted to balance the head, which makes it easier to keep your strikes even and controlled, particularly over a longer texturing session.

Oxidising your piece once you're done brings the sandstone texture out properly. The recesses darken while the raised surface stays bright, so the grain of the texture actually reads instead of disappearing into a flat, even tone. It works well across a whole piece or in smaller, isolated patches for contrast against a smooth surface.

This is a finishing tool, used once your piece is already shaped. Rest your work on a steel bench block for a solid surface to strike against, and build the texture up gradually rather than trying to get there in a few heavy blows.

Worth knowing:

  • Best suited to soft metals: silver, copper and gold
